{"id":212105,"created":"2025-01-19T01:13:07.427090+00:00","metadata":{"_oai":{"id":"oai:ipsj.ixsq.nii.ac.jp:00212105","sets":["1164:3925:10503:10641"]},"path":["10641"],"owner":"44499","recid":"212105","title":["PUFを信頼の基点としたRISC-V TEE環境の実装"],"pubdate":{"attribute_name":"公開日","attribute_value":"2021-07-12"},"_buckets":{"deposit":"94d28983-a74d-49f9-b530-037991e43335"},"_deposit":{"id":"212105","pid":{"type":"depid","value":"212105","revision_id":0},"owners":[44499],"status":"published","created_by":44499},"item_title":"PUFを信頼の基点としたRISC-V TEE環境の実装","author_link":["540294","540296","540297","540295","540293","540298"],"item_titles":{"attribute_name":"タイトル","attribute_value_mlt":[{"subitem_title":"PUFを信頼の基点としたRISC-V TEE環境の実装"},{"subitem_title":"Implimentation of RISC-V TEE using PUF as Root of Trust","subitem_title_language":"en"}]},"item_keyword":{"attribute_name":"キーワード","attribute_value_mlt":[{"subitem_subject":"HWS ","subitem_subject_scheme":"Other"}]},"item_type_id":"4","publish_date":"2021-07-12","item_4_text_3":{"attribute_name":"著者所属","attribute_value_mlt":[{"subitem_text_value":"立命館大学理工学研究科"},{"subitem_text_value":"セキュアオープンアーキテクチャ・エッジ基盤技術研究組合/産業技術総合研究所サイバーフィジカルセキュリティ研究センター"},{"subitem_text_value":"立命館大学理工学部"}]},"item_4_text_4":{"attribute_name":"著者所属(英)","attribute_value_mlt":[{"subitem_text_value":"Graduate School of Science and Technology, Ritsumeikan University","subitem_text_language":"en"},{"subitem_text_value":" Technology Research Association of Secure IoT Edge Application based on RISC-V Open Architecture / National Institute of Advanced Industrial Science and Technology, Cyber Physical Security Research Center","subitem_text_language":"en"},{"subitem_text_value":"Department of Science and Engineering, Ritsumeikan University","subitem_text_language":"en"}]},"item_language":{"attribute_name":"言語","attribute_value_mlt":[{"subitem_language":"jpn"}]},"item_publisher":{"attribute_name":"出版者","attribute_value_mlt":[{"subitem_publisher":"情報処理学会","subitem_publisher_language":"ja"}]},"publish_status":"0","weko_shared_id":-1,"item_file_price":{"attribute_name":"Billing file","attribute_type":"file","attribute_value_mlt":[{"url":{"url":"https://ipsj.ixsq.nii.ac.jp/record/212105/files/IPSJ-CSEC21094040.pdf","label":"IPSJ-CSEC21094040.pdf"},"format":"application/pdf","billing":["billing_file"],"filename":"IPSJ-CSEC21094040.pdf","filesize":[{"value":"2.6 MB"}],"mimetype":"application/pdf","priceinfo":[{"tax":["include_tax"],"price":"0","billingrole":"30"},{"tax":["include_tax"],"price":"0","billingrole":"44"}],"accessrole":"open_login","version_id":"e7d222a3-80ab-4821-a89e-7d2919a4ff68","displaytype":"detail","licensetype":"license_note","license_note":"Copyright (c) 2021 by the Institute of Electronics, Information and Communication Engineers This SIG report is only available to those in membership of the SIG."}]},"item_4_creator_5":{"attribute_name":"著者名","attribute_type":"creator","attribute_value_mlt":[{"creatorNames":[{"creatorName":"吉田, 康太"}],"nameIdentifiers":[{}]},{"creatorNames":[{"creatorName":"須崎, 有康"}],"nameIdentifiers":[{}]},{"creatorNames":[{"creatorName":"藤野, 毅"}],"nameIdentifiers":[{}]}]},"item_4_creator_6":{"attribute_name":"著者名(英)","attribute_type":"creator","attribute_value_mlt":[{"creatorNames":[{"creatorName":"Kota, Yoshida","creatorNameLang":"en"}],"nameIdentifiers":[{}]},{"creatorNames":[{"creatorName":"Kuniyasu, Suzaki","creatorNameLang":"en"}],"nameIdentifiers":[{}]},{"creatorNames":[{"creatorName":"Takeshi, Fujino","creatorNameLang":"en"}],"nameIdentifiers":[{}]}]},"item_4_source_id_9":{"attribute_name":"書誌レコードID","attribute_value_mlt":[{"subitem_source_identifier":"AA11235941","subitem_source_identifier_type":"NCID"}]},"item_4_textarea_12":{"attribute_name":"Notice","attribute_value_mlt":[{"subitem_textarea_value":"SIG Technical Reports are nonrefereed and hence may later appear in any journals, conferences, symposia, etc."}]},"item_resource_type":{"attribute_name":"資源タイプ","attribute_value_mlt":[{"resourceuri":"http://purl.org/coar/resource_type/c_18gh","resourcetype":"technical report"}]},"item_4_source_id_11":{"attribute_name":"ISSN","attribute_value_mlt":[{"subitem_source_identifier":"2188-8655","subitem_source_identifier_type":"ISSN"}]},"item_4_description_7":{"attribute_name":"論文抄録","attribute_value_mlt":[{"subitem_description":"Society5.0 において,フィジカル空間に配置された膨大な数の IoT デバイスから信頼できるデータを収集するためには,フィジカル空間に配置された IoT デバイスとソフトウェアの真正性を検証する必要がある.これは,暗号アルゴリズムのようなクリティカルな処理を通常の OS から隔離された環境で実行する TEE と,デバイスに実装された信頼の基点,デバイスとソフトウェアの真正性を第三者が確認する手段であるリモートアテステーションの技術 によって実現される.RISC-V Keystone は RISC-V ISA 上で TEE を実現するためのオープンフレームワークであるが, 現時点では TEE とリモートアテステーション機能のみが提供されており,信頼の基点の安全な実装は別途実施する必要がある.本稿では,RISC-V Keystone における信頼の基点として,PUF を使用する実装を紹介する.PUF を用いてデバイス固有鍵を生成することにより,セキュアな不揮発性メモリを実装して鍵書き込みを行う必要がなくなり,低コストで高いセキュリティを実現することができる.","subitem_description_type":"Other"}]},"item_4_description_8":{"attribute_name":"論文抄録(英)","attribute_value_mlt":[{"subitem_description":"In society 5.0, acquiring trustworthy data from a huge amount of IoT devices in physical spaces, it is important to verify the authenticity of IoT devices and software. It is achieved by TEE, root of trust, and remote attestation. TEE is an isolated execution environment to execute critical software such as cryptographic processes and handling secret keys. The root of trust provides a device-specific key and the remote attestation provides means for third parties to verify the authenticity of the device and software. RISC-V Keystone is an open framework to implement TEE on RISC-V ISA. Keystone provides TEE and remote attestation framework, however root of trust have to be additionally implemented. In this paper, we introduce an implementation that uses PUF as a root of trust in RISC-V Keystone. It is not necessary to deploy a secret key into a secure non-volatile memory by using PUF as a secure key generator, so high security can be realized at a low cost.","subitem_description_type":"Other"}]},"item_4_biblio_info_10":{"attribute_name":"書誌情報","attribute_value_mlt":[{"bibliographicPageEnd":"6","bibliographic_titles":[{"bibliographic_title":"研究報告コンピュータセキュリティ(CSEC)"}],"bibliographicPageStart":"1","bibliographicIssueDates":{"bibliographicIssueDate":"2021-07-12","bibliographicIssueDateType":"Issued"},"bibliographicIssueNumber":"40","bibliographicVolumeNumber":"2021-CSEC-94"}]},"relation_version_is_last":true,"weko_creator_id":"44499"},"updated":"2025-01-19T17:36:09.353467+00:00","links":{}}